    Happy Days | September 23rd, 2024

    Last week, the Fed cut rates by 50 basis points, sparking a 2.1% surge in small-cap equities and boosting the S&P 500 and Nasdaq by 1.5%. Gold hit new highs, oil rallied by 5%, and bond markets showed signs of recovery with an upward-moving 10-2 spread. The U.S. economy appears on a "soft landing" path, with unemployment claims dropping sharply. This week, all eyes are on Jerome Powell’s remarks at the U.S. Treasury Market Conference and key economic indicators, including September’s flash PMIs and the core personal consumption expenditures price index for August.     Kangaroo Bounce | September 16th, 2024

    Last week, markets saw a "kangaroo" trend, with investor sentiment bouncing between fear and optimism as the Fed prepares for an expected rate cut. The S&P 500 rallied by 4%, nearly reaching its record high, while the Nasdaq surged 6%, supported by positive economic data and inflation reports. Bonds and gold also thrived, with gold hitting a record high and Treasury yields dropping. This week, attention shifts to the Fed's decision on interest rate cuts, with analysts expecting either a 25 or 50 basis point reduction, likely benefiting small caps, financials, gold, and dividend-paying stocks.     Bumpy Landing | September 9th, 2024

    Last week, the market experienced its worst start to September since 1946, with the Technology and Oil & Gas sectors leading a sharp decline, while defensive sectors like Utilities and Consumer Goods showed resilience. Concerns about the Federal Reserve’s delay in lowering interest rates grew after weak economic reports, including the lowest job openings in three years and a modest increase in payrolls. Broadcom's disappointing guidance triggered a 10.3% drop in its stock, along with other AI-related companies, while bond market investors benefited from falling Treasury yields. Looking ahead, investors are eyeing the upcoming CPI release on Wednesday, ahead of the Federal Reserve's September meeting.     No Summertime Blues | September 3rd, 2024

    Stock market investors enjoyed a summer rally, overcoming Nvidia's 7% decline, with value stocks like Berkshire Hathaway reaching significant milestones. The bond market signaled optimism as the 10-2 Treasury yield spread reversed its post-Covid inversion, reducing recession fears. The Federal Reserve's focus remained on inflation, with the PCE report supporting the case for future interest rate cuts. Looking ahead, Wall Street will concentrate on labor market data, including job openings, private employment, and nonfarm payrolls.     What Time Is It Chairman Powell? | August 26th, 2024

    Federal Reserve Chair Jerome Powell signaled the possibility of interest rate cuts during the Jackson Hole Economic Symposium, sparking a market rally, particularly in small-cap stocks and mid-cap indices. Bond yields dropped, leading to a narrowing yield curve, which could indicate a more optimistic economic outlook. The dollar's decline has benefited international markets and U.S. companies with overseas revenues, while lower rates have also driven gold prices to all-time highs. Looking ahead, Nvidia's earnings report and key economic indicators like jobless claims and the Fed's PCE inflation gauge are expected to influence market volatility this week.     Goldilocks and the Bears Are Back | August 19th, 2024

    Last week, equities rallied to their best performance of the year, driven by stronger-than-expected retail sales, low unemployment claims, and solid earnings from Walmart, pushing the S&P 500 within 2% of its record high. Tech stocks led the surge, with the Nasdaq Composite jumping 5.3%, while small caps and gold also saw gains as the bond market stabilized. Investor fears of a recession eased as a "Goldilocks" scenario emerged, balancing economic data that wasn't too hot or cold. This week, focus shifts to the Fed with the release of FOMC minutes and the upcoming Jackson Hole Symposium, where all eyes will be on Powell's next move.     Volatility Traders Awaken | August 12th, 2024

    Last week saw significant market volatility, with the S&P 500 experiencing its worst trading session since September 2022 on Monday, followed by a strong recovery on Thursday. Despite this, the S&P 500 ended the week nearly flat, while the Nasdaq and Russell 2000 posted small losses. The bond market also fluctuated, with the 10-year Treasury yield rising to 3.93% after touching its lowest level of the year. This week, market focus shifts to the upcoming CPI report and retail earnings, which could influence the Federal Reserve's next interest rate decision.     Disconnected Dots | August 5th, 2024

    Last week, investor sentiment shifted dramatically from Greed to Fear due to soft economic data and unresponsive FOMC statements, causing major market declines. Despite solid corporate earnings, the S&P 500 fell 2.1%, the Nasdaq dropped 3.4%, and the Russell 2000 plummeted 6.7%, with the VIX spiking and bond yields falling. The Fed's continued restrictive monetary policy amidst a slowing economy raised concerns of a potential hard landing, further amplified by weak manufacturing and employment data. This week, investors remain cautious with the Nasdaq in correction territory, high volatility, and global markets selling off. Key focus areas include U.S. services sector data, initial jobless claims, and major earnings reports, alongside geopolitical tensions and domestic political instability.
